How it works

Tramazide D 75mg/50mg Tablet is a combination of two medicines: Diclofenac and Tramadol, which relieves severe pain. Diclofenac is a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ID) which works by blocking the release of certain chemical messengers that cause pain and inflammation (redness and swelling). Breast feeding

Safe when prescribed by an expert: Tramazide D 75mg/50mg Tablet is probably safe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ug does not represent any significant risk to the baby. Frequently asked questions

Yes, long-term use of Tramazide D 75mg/50mg Tablet can damage kidneys by lowering protective prostaglandin levels. It is not recommended for patients with existing kidney disease.
Yes, Tramazide D 75mg/50mg Tablet can cause dry mouth. Stay hydrated by drinking water regularly and consider using lip balm for dry lips.
Yes, Tramazide D 75mg/50mg Tablet can cause constipation. Consult your doctor if it persists.
Store Tramazide D 75mg/50mg Tablet in its original container, tightly closed, following the label instructions. Dispose of unused medicine safely to prevent accidental ingestion by others.
Tramazide D 75mg/50mg Tablet should be avoided by those allergic to its components, and it can interact negatively with sedatives and MAO inhibitors. It is not recommended for patients with severe liver disease or epilepsy.
Tramazide D 75mg/50mg Tablet can usually be discontinued when your pain is relieved, unless your doctor advises otherwise.
